Island Satu (one) Gili Islands🏝

East of Bali, off the coast of Lombok, are the three paradise Gili Islands - Gili Trawangan, Gili Meno and Gili Air. Three different bounty islands, each with its own atmosphere. The largest island is Gili Trawangan and is especially popular with partying backpackers. 🎒Gili Meno is the middle island and has the most beautiful beaches of the three and good diving spots like the Meno Wall. After 9 p.m. there is hardly anything to do, so Gili Meno is mainly an island for people looking for peace and quiet and families. Gili Air is closest to Lombok and in terms of crowds falls between Gili Trawangan and Gili Meno. Here you will find the most beautiful accommodations of the three Gili islands (Tip: Slow Gili Air). Motorised transport is prohibited on all three islands, so you must travel by bicycle, on foot or by horse and cart.
The Gili Islands are reached by boat from Bali or Lombok. Accommodation can be arranged on the spot outside the high season, but in the low season it is better to book in.

Island Dua (two) Nusa Lembongan (Nusa Ceningan and Nusa Penida)🏝

Just south-east of Bali are the three islands of Nusa Lembongan, Nusa Ceningan and Nusa Penida. On Nusa Lembongan, you will find the most accommodations and this is also where most of the boats from Bali dock. It is a lovely compact island that is perfect to explore by scooter. 🛵Narrow roads will take you to beaches such as Dream Beach and Sandy Bay Beach or make a stop at the Devil's Tear, where waves spectacularly crash against the rocks.

You could cross to the even smaller neighbouring island of Nusa Ceningan via the yellow 'suspension bridge', but it collapsed in October 2016 killing 9 people. Currently, the bridge is being repaired and you can cross via boats. On Nusa Ceningan you will find the Blue Lagoon, Secret Beach and a viewpoint to Nusa Penida.

Nusa Penida is the largest of the three islands and also the most unspoilt. It has beautiful cliffs and bays such as Angel's Billabong, Pasih Uwug and Atuh Beach and there are some great dive spots around the island. 🤿Manta Point is the place to spot manta rays and at Crystal Bay, among others, you have the chance to see the giant Mola Mola. Island Tiga (three) 🏝

Lombok is one of the Lesser Sunda Islands and is also called the 'Island of a thousand mosques'. The population here is mainly (strictly) Muslim. Apart from beach resorts such as Senggigi and Kuta, Lombok is still a wonderfully quiet island where it is good for diving and snorkelling in clear blue waters. 🤿Lombok is also popular among surfers and you will find beautiful unspoilt nature and green rice fields. The literal and figurative highlight of Lombok is the mighty 3727-metre-high Gunung Rinjani volcano with its Segara Anak crater lake.🌋

Island Empat (four) Flores 🏝

The most beautiful nature 🌿 of all the Sunda Islands can be found on Flores. Not only will you find here extraordinary volcanoes with coloured crater lakes, but also savannahs, mountain forests and a magnificent underwater world. A must-do on Flores is the ascent of the Kelimutu volcano. On the way up, you will pass traditional villages and the view of the three crater lakes, which vary from green and turquoise to dark red, is amazing.

Island Lima (five) Komodo 🏝

Flores is easy to combine with the beautiful neighbouring island of Komodo. On this island, the infamous Komodo dragons 🦎 live and you will find beautiful white sandy beaches and the popular Pink Beach. 💗 As the large monitor lizards can be dangerous to humans, you are not allowed to visit the park on your own and must be accompanied by a guide. Komodo also offers great diving facilities and you can spot dolphins, sharks, giant mantas and even blue whales. Apart from the white sandy beaches, the landscape in Komodo National Park (which further consists of the islands of Rinca and Padar) is mainly lush green.🌿
